How Our Water Mitigation Process Works
When water invades your property, a structured, professional approach is essential. Cutting corners here can lead to mold growth, compromised structural integrity, and lingering odors. Our team follows a proven method designed to extract water quickly, dry your property thoroughly, and restore your home or business. We work closely with your insurance company to ensure all necessary steps are documented and covered, making the financial aspect less of a worry for you.
Emergency Water Extraction
This is the critical first step. Our crews arrive promptly with powerful truck-mounted and portable extraction units to remove standing water. We’ll target bulk water removal from carpets, floors, and furniture. This phase can take anywhere from a few hours to a full day, depending on the volume of water.
Structural Drying
Once standing water is gone, we deploy specialized equipment like high-speed air movers and industrial dehumidifiers. These work together to accelerate the evaporation process from walls, floors, and ceilings. This stage typically lasts 2-5 days, but can extend depending on building materials and the extent of saturation.
Moisture Detection and Monitoring
We don’t guess when it comes to drying. Our technicians use advanced moisture meters and thermal imaging cameras to pinpoint hidden dampness within structures. We track moisture levels daily to ensure materials are drying uniformly. This monitoring continues until your property meets industry standards for dryness.
Deodorizing and Sanitizing
Water damage often brings unpleasant odors and potential health hazards. We use professional-grade antimicrobial and deodorizing treatments to neutralize bacteria and mold spores. This step is vital for restoring a healthy living environment and preventing future problems.
Content Cleaning and Restoration
We carefully assess your belongings for salvageability. Items like furniture, documents, and electronics may require specialized cleaning and restoration techniques to save valuable possessions. We handle this with care, aiming to restore as much as possible.

Warning Signs You Need Water Mitigation Services
Ignoring early signs of water intrusion can lead to much more extensive and costly damage down the line. Catching these indicators early allows our team to intervene quickly, saving you time, money, and potential health risks. It’s always better to be proactive when it comes to water in your home.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ent, damp, or moldy smell, especially in basements or bathrooms, is a strong indicator of hidden moisture. This smell signals potential mold growth and needs immediate attention.
Discolored or Peeling Paint/Wallpaper
Water seeping behind finishes will cause them to bubble, peel, or change color. This is a clear sign of water saturation behind surfaces and requires investigation.
Warped or Stained Ceilings and Walls
Visible sagging, staining, or soft spots on your walls or ceiling indicate that water has soaked into the building materials. This type of damage needs urgent structural drying.
Slow Drains or Sewage Backups
If your drains are sluggish or you’ve experienced a sewage backup, this is a direct sign of plumbing issues and potential contamination. This requires specialized handling and immediate cleanup.
Increased Humidity Levels
A sudden increase in indoor humidity, making the air feel heavy or sticky, can point to a hidden leak or inadequate ventilation allowing moisture to build up. High humidity fosters mold and degrades materials.
New Water Spots or Puddles
Any new appearance of water spots on floors, ceilings, or walls, or unexplained puddles, means water is actively present. This is direct evidence of a leak and requires immediate extraction.
Water Mitigation Services v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small spill on hard floor (tile, vinyl) | Yes | No | Easy to wipe up and dry with towels. |
| Minor leak from sink trap | Maybe | Yes | Can be messy, potential for hidden mold. |
| Standing water from burst pipe (few gallons) | No | Yes | Requires specialized extraction equipment for thorough drying. |
| Sewage backup or contaminated water | Absolutely Not | Yes | Health hazard; requires professional containment and sanitization. |
| Water damage affecting drywall or insulation | No | Yes | Materials absorb water and need professional drying to prevent mold. |
| Persistent dampness after a leak | No | Yes | Hidden moisture requires advanced detection and drying. |
While small, contained spills might be manageable for a DIY approach, any significant water intrusion or water from unknown sources requires professional intervention. Our team has the equipment and expertise to handle complex water damage scenarios safely and effectively.
Water Mitigation Services Cost In Norcross, GA
The cost of water mitigation services in Norcross, GA can vary significantly based on the extent of the water damage, the size of the affected area, and the complexity of the job. These price ranges offer a general idea of what you might expect.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Volume of water, accessibility of affected areas. |
| Structural Drying (Air Movers, Dehumidifiers) |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of space, duration of drying needed, number of units. |
| Moisture Detection and Monitoring | $300 – $1,000 | Use of advanced equipment like thermal cameras. |
| Deodorizing and Sanitizing | $400 – $1,500 | Type of treatments used, size of the area treated. |
| Content Cleaning and Restoration | Varies | Number and type of items, extent of damage to each item. |
| Damage Assessment and Reporting | $200 – $800 | Detailed documentation required for insurance claims. |
An on-site assessment is always necessary for an accurate quote. We offer free estimates to help you understand the total mitigation costs involved.

Common Questions About Water Mitigation Services
My insurance company says I need water mitigation. What does that mean?
Water mitigation refers to the process of stopping the source of water damage, removing excess water, and drying out your property as quickly as possible. The goal is to minimize damage and prevent secondary issues like mold. Our team works directly with insurance adjusters to document the damage and perform the necessary drying and extraction steps required by your policy.

What are the health risks associated with water damage if not addressed properly?
Untreated water damage can quickly lead to mold growth, which can cause respiratory problems, allergic reactions, and other health issues. Stagnant water can also harbor bacteria and contaminants. Proper water mitigation prevents mold and sanitizes affected areas, ensuring a safer environment for your family.
How long does the water mitigation process typically take?
The initial water extraction might take a few hours to a day, depending on the volume. The structural drying process, using our equipment, usually takes between 3 to 5 days. However, this can vary based on the extent of saturation and building materials. We monitor drying progress closely to ensure completion.
Can I prevent water damage from happening again?
While some water damage is unavoidable, like severe storms, many issues can be prevented. Regular maintenance of plumbing, roofs, and gutters can help. Addressing small leaks promptly and ensuring proper drainage around your foundation are key steps. We can also provide advice on maintaining a dry home after we’ve completed mitigation services.
